НТУУ КПИ
Факультет: ФЭЛ (ИПСА)
Кафедра: САПР (СП)
Преподаватель: Капшук
Специальность: Информационные технологии проектирования
Дисциплина: Методы и средства компьютерных информационных технологий (3 курс)
Страниц: 24 + файлы исходных текстов программ (Borland Pascal)
Основное содержание работы - разработка программы-архиватора, реализующего упаковку/распаковку файлов с помощью методов сжатия Хаффмена и "код Шеннона-Фано" (КШФ). Программа также рассчитывает среднюю энтропию на символ файла до и после сжатия. В отчете приведены краткие теоретические сведения, подробно описаны вышеупомянутые алгоритмы сжатия, описана разработанная программа. Выполнено сравнение результатов работы разработанной программы по сжатию файлов с результатами сжатия архиватором WinRar, а также сравнение эффективности методов КШФ и Хаффмена. Сформулированы выводы по работе.
Содержание отчета
Цель работы
Программа работы
Краткие теоретические сведения
Алгоритмы построения КШФ и Хаффмена
Алгоритм декодирования КШФ и Хаффмена
Описание структуры закодированных файлов
Краткое описание программы
Блок-схема программы кодирования данных
Блок-схема программы декодирования данных
Результаты
Текст программы
Выводы по работе
Факультет: ФЭЛ (ИПСА)
Кафедра: САПР (СП)
Преподаватель: Капшук
Специальность: Информационные технологии проектирования
Дисциплина: Методы и средства компьютерных информационных технологий (3 курс)
Страниц: 24 + файлы исходных текстов программ (Borland Pascal)
Основное содержание работы - разработка программы-архиватора, реализующего упаковку/распаковку файлов с помощью методов сжатия Хаффмена и "код Шеннона-Фано" (КШФ). Программа также рассчитывает среднюю энтропию на символ файла до и после сжатия. В отчете приведены краткие теоретические сведения, подробно описаны вышеупомянутые алгоритмы сжатия, описана разработанная программа. Выполнено сравнение результатов работы разработанной программы по сжатию файлов с результатами сжатия архиватором WinRar, а также сравнение эффективности методов КШФ и Хаффмена. Сформулированы выводы по работе.
Содержание отчета
Цель работы
Программа работы
Краткие теоретические сведения
Алгоритмы построения КШФ и Хаффмена
Алгоритм декодирования КШФ и Хаффмена
Описание структуры закодированных файлов
Краткое описание программы
Блок-схема программы кодирования данных
Блок-схема программы декодирования данных
Результаты
Текст программы
Выводы по работе